| /** |
| * An ObjectStoreService is mainly used in SMILA to store binary data during bulk processing. Data objects in this |
| * service are for example big bulks of records that are to be processed in a single step by some worker. Of course, the |
| * ObjectStoreService can also be used to store small objects like record attachments or other auxiliary data. Apart |
| * from reading and writing objects (either as blobs or using streams), blobs can be appended to objects, objects can be |
| * removed, and it is possible to get a list of descriptions ({@link StoreObject}) about the current objects in a store, |
| * optionally filtered by a prefix string on the object ID. |
| * |
| * Objects are identified by a {@link String} identifiers. All implementations must support these chars:: |
| * <ul> |
| * <li>ASCII characters: 'a'-'z', 'A'-'Z' |
| * <li>numbers: '0'-'9' |
| * <li>underscores, dashes and slashes: '_', '-', '/' |
| * </ul> |
| * Specific implementations may allow more characters. |
| * |
| * The ObjectStoreService manages objects in stores. A store can be thought of as a container of objects of the same |
| * kind. A store must be created before it can be used to store and fetch objects. In some implementations of this |
| * service it is possible that different stores have different properties, for example concerning the reliability of |
| * this store like replication of the data objects. Such properties must be specified at creation time, or the service |
| * will create a store with default properties. The properties that can be used are dependant on the specific service |
| * implementation. |
| */ |
